In this episode, Jens is joined by Dr Jeff Brand and IGEA CEO, Ron Curry, to unpack the latest Australia Plays report, now marking 20 years of tracking how the nation plays. Together, they explore what the data reveals about modern Australia: games as an intergenerational pastime, the rise of female players to 51%, and the powerful role games play in connection, wellbeing, and digital literacy.
From cosy games to family bonding to the uniquely Australian flavour of our homegrown titles, the conversation reflects on how games have become a cultural staple, as familiar and universal as sport, music, or film. It’s a lively look at where gaming has been, where it’s heading, and why Australia remains one of the most exciting places in the world to play and make games.
